Junior/Intermediate Flutter/Dart Developer

waltworks South Africa
Remote
Apply
AI Summary

We're looking for a remote junior/intermediate Flutter/Dart developer to join our team on a contract basis. The role involves developing and maintaining mobile applications and backend services for our clients. The ideal candidate should have proficiency in Flutter/Dart, C#, and Git, with strong problem-solving skills and attention to detail.

Key Highlights
Develop and maintain mobile applications using Flutter/Dart
Contribute to backend REST services in C# (.NET)
Participate in code reviews and testing
Key Responsibilities
Develop and maintain mobile applications using Flutter/Dart
Contribute to backend REST services in C# (.NET)
Write clean, well-structured, maintainable code
Participate in code reviews and testing
Technical Skills Required
Flutter Dart C# Git
Benefits & Perks
Competitive market rate based on experience and qualifications
Flexible schedule suited to remote work
Mentorship and technical guidance from our founder and senior developers
Nice to Have
Potential to work with Golang on future projects

Job Description


*Company Overview*


Waltworks is a South Africa-based software studio that builds custom digital solutions across industries, from agricultural data platforms to GIS and accounting systems. We write robust, intelligent code that drives efficiency and accuracy at scale. If you want to build things that matter, with real autonomy and real impact, we'd like to hear from you.


*Job Overview*


We're looking for a Remote Junior/Intermediate Flutter/Dart Developer to join our team on a contract basis. This is a fully remote role focused on developing and maintaining mobile applications and backend services for our clients. You'll work closely with experienced developers who'll guide your growth, but day-to-day you'll be expected to operate independently: researching, planning, and shipping quality work on your own initiative.


*What We Value*


We're looking for someone who thrives working independently. The kind of developer who hits a problem, researches it thoroughly, forms an approach, and then brings it to the team for discussion, not just the question. We provide mentorship, architecture guidance, and regular code reviews, but we need someone who takes ownership of their work from start to finish. Come to us with a plan, not a blank stare. If you're self-directed, resourceful, and naturally inclined to figure things out before escalating, you'll fit right in.


*Key Responsibilities*


Development

•⁠ ⁠Develop and maintain mobile applications using Flutter/Dart

•⁠ ⁠Contribute to backend REST services in C# (.NET)

•⁠ ⁠Write clean, well-structured, maintainable code

•⁠ ⁠Participate in code reviews and testing

•⁠ ⁠Potential to work with Golang on future projects


Professional Growth

•⁠ ⁠Receive mentorship and technical guidance from our founder and senior developers

•⁠ ⁠Stay current with mobile development trends and best practices

•⁠ ⁠Grow through hands-on work on production systems, not tutorials


Collaboration

•⁠ ⁠Work under the guidance of our founder

•⁠ ⁠Participate in remote standups and code review sessions

•⁠ ⁠Give and receive feedback openly


*Required Qualifications*


•⁠ ⁠Bachelor's degree in Computer Science, Engineering, or related field (or equivalent self-taught experience with a strong portfolio)


*Required Skills*


•⁠ ⁠Proficiency in Flutter/Dart and C#

•⁠ ⁠Working knowledge of Git and version control workflows

•⁠ ⁠Strong problem-solving ability and attention to detail

•⁠ ⁠Clear written communication (critical for remote work)

•⁠ ⁠Ability to work independently in a remote environment with minimal supervision


*Employment Type*


Fully remote 12-month contract with option to renew.


*Work Hours*


40 hours per week / 160 hours per month. Flexible schedule suited to remote work.


*Compensation*


Competitive market rate based on experience and qualifications.


*How to Apply*


Submit your CV and a link to your GitHub profile (if available) demonstrating your development work. Applications are reviewed on a rolling basis.


*NOTE:* Please do not contact our staff directly. Applications not submitted through this job post will be ignored.



Similar Jobs

Explore other opportunities that match your interests

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Mid-Senior level

hotsourced

South Africa

Highly Experienced React Native Developer

Mobile
4h ago

Premium Job

Sign up is free! Login or Sign up to view full details.

•••••• •••••• ••••••
Job Type ••••••
Experience Level ••••••

Grid Dynamics

Portugal
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Associate

hirenza

United State

Subscribe our newsletter

New Things Will Always Update Regularly